#376 introduced `src/lib/utils/sanitize.ts` as the single markdown sanitize policy, and the comment on its `FORBID_TAGS: ['style']` entry argues the preview case specifically: the sanitized HTML is injected into the app's own document, where a document `<style>` can hide the title bar or turn any selector into an outbound beacon. Only the export path ever imported it. The preview kept a local copy of the URI regexp and passed `ALLOWED_URI_REGEXP` alone, so `<style>` - which DOMPurify allows by default, CSS unfiltered - reached the live document. Measured in a browser against the pinned DOMPurify build: the title bar's computed `display` became `none` and the outbound request for the beacon appears in `performance.getEntriesByType('resource')`. The app CSP permits both halves. The deleted regexp was byte-identical to the shared one, so no URI behaviour changes; the only delta is that author `<style>` is dropped. The order difference between the two sinks is left alone and now documented: export sanitizes first because its bytes leave the app and filtering Markpad's own generated markup could silently delete part of the export; the preview sanitizes last because it has no second line of defence, so the string reaching `{@html}` must BE the sanitizer's output with no round trip after it. …cannot delete them (#455) Every diagram whose labels Mermaid put in a `<foreignObject>` rendered as empty shapes — in the live preview and in the exported HTML alike, because both call `renderRichContent` → `sanitizeDiagramSvg`. ## Mechanism `sanitizeDiagramSvg` allowed the `foreignObject` *element*: DOMPurify.sanitize(svg, { ADD_TAGS: ['foreignObject'], ADD_ATTR: [...] }) The label is not the element. It is the HTML inside it — `<div class="labelBkg">…<span class="nodeLabel">Alpha</span></div>` — and DOMPurify deletes HTML children of an SVG element unless the parent is an HTML integration point: // dompurify 3.4.12, dist/purify.es.mjs const HTML_INTEGRATION_POINTS = freeze(['annotation-xml']); _checkHtmlNamespace = function (tagName, parent, parentTagName) { if (parent.namespaceURI === SVG_NAMESPACE && !HTML_INTEGRATION_POINTS[parentTagName]) return false; `foreignobject` is not on that list, so no `ADD_TAGS` entry could save its children. `DOMPurify.removed` grew one entry per label and what survived was literally `<foreignObject width="37.98" height="24"></foreignObject>`. ## Scope, measured Real mermaid 11.16.0 driven by real dompurify 3.4.12 in a browser, over every diagram type 11.16.0 ships a renderer for — not only the five sampled in the report: labels entirely deleted (10) flowchart, flowchart-v2, classDiagram, stateDiagram, stateDiagram-v2, erDiagram, requirementDiagram, mindmap, block, kanban labels hidden (1) journey — see the `<switch>` note below unaffected sequence, gantt, pie, quadrantChart, gitGraph, C4Context, timeline, sankey, xychart, architecture, info, ishikawa, wardley, treemap, packet, radar, treeView — all SVG `<text>` ## The fix `mermaid.initialize` now passes `htmlLabels: false`. Mermaid then emits SVG `<text>`, which no sanitizer objects to; every label above survives. One root-level key is enough — the per-diagram `flowchart.htmlLabels` / `class.htmlLabels` / … settings are deprecated in 11.x and the root one takes precedence over them — so the diagram-specific keys are deliberately not set. Because nothing then depends on HTML inside the SVG, `foreignObject` also leaves `sanitizeDiagramSvg`'s `ADD_TAGS`. Nothing needs it: - Mermaid still emits `foreignObject` unconditionally in three places — venn `text` nodes, eventmodeling boxes, architecture `iconText` — but their HTML children are deleted by the rule above whether or not the tag is allowed, so the allowance could only ever produce an empty box. Measured: venn's "Bravo" label is absent with the tag allowed and absent without it. - The `<switch>`-based renderers (journey by default, and anything configured `textPlacement: 'fo'`) pair the `foreignObject` with an SVG `<text>` fallback. A browser renders the first child it supports, so an emptied-but-present `foreignObject` *suppressed* a label that had come through the filter intact. Measured: the journey's task labels are 0×0 with the tag on the allowlist and 37×20 with it removed. Dropping it fixes a diagram `htmlLabels: false` alone cannot. So the filter gets smaller, not larger. ## The rejected alternative DOMPurify 3.4.12 accepts `HTML_INTEGRATION_POINTS` as a config option, so allowing `foreignObject` to be an integration point is a candidate fix that would have preserved rendering fidelity exactly. Two findings: - It only works as an object map. `HTML_INTEGRATION_POINTS: ['annotation-xml', 'foreignobject']` is a silent no-op — the value is `clone()`d, and cloning an array yields index keys, which also drops `annotation-xml`. Passing `{ 'annotation-xml': true, foreignobject: true }` does restore every label. - It is the wrong trade. It re-permits HTML inside SVG, which DOMPurify keeps out on purpose because serialise-then-reparse is the mutation-XSS primitive — and `container.innerHTML = sanitizeDiagramSvg(svg)` is exactly that reparse. Mermaid source is document content, so the SVG is attacker-influenced; #384 exists in this same cycle because a document's `<style>` reached the app's own DOM. Measured difference: with the override, `<svg><foreignObject><img src=x></foreignObject></svg>` survives sanitisation and materialises as a live `<img>` on the reparse, where today (and with this fix) it does not. ## Trade-offs of `htmlLabels: false` - Markup inside a node label renders literally: `A["<b>bold</b> text"]` comes out as the six characters `<b>` followed by `bold`. No sample, test or doc in this repo puts HTML in a Mermaid label (checked: `samples/` has one diagram, `graph TD` with plain labels). - KaTeX inside a label goes the same way — Mermaid's math path runs only under `useHtmlLabels` — so `A["$$x^2$$"]` renders as its source. It rendered as nothing at all before this change, so this is not a loss. - Wrapping is measured by the SVG text engine instead of the browser's layout, so long labels break at slightly different points. ## Not a v2.7.0 regression The allowance predates this cycle: it was introduced in eb9a1c7 ("Fix Mermaid diagram rendering with SVG foreignObject support", 2026-02-04) and #411 only moved it into `richContent.ts`. v2.6.13 ships the byte-identical config, and the dompurify it shipped with (3.3.1) has the same `addToSet({}, ['annotation-xml'])` and the same SVG-namespace check. So the release does not have to hold for this. ## Tests `scripts/mermaidDiagramLabels.test.ts` runs the real `renderRichContent` over a real code block with Mermaid answered out of `scripts/mermaidDiagramCorpus.json` — bytes real mermaid 11.16.0 emitted, captured once with the old config and once with the new one, and keyed by the config the pipeline actually sends, so a config nobody has measured is an error rather than a pass. It parses what the pipeline produced and asserts there is no HTML in the SVG for the namespace rule to reach and that every label is in an SVG `<text>`. What it cannot execute is DOMPurify: without a DOM the library returns a bare factory with no `sanitize` at all, so it is stood in for by the identity function as `exportRichContent.test.ts` already does, and a third test asserts that state so the middle one is not misread as "the filter kept the labels". Making that half real needs a DOM faithful enough to reproduce HTML5 foreign-content parsing, which is the rule under test — a shim written here would be marking its own homework, and no test-only DOM dependency was added. Falsified: with only `htmlLabels: false` reverted, the corpus stand-in returns the old bytes and the middle test fails with `flowchart: the rendered diagram still carries its labels in foreignObject, whose HTML children DOMPurify removes regardless of ADD_TAGS`, 3 !== 0. `previewSanitize.test.ts` asserted the source text `ADD_TAGS: ['foreignObject']`. That assertion confirmed a config string existed while every label was being stripped, so it is replaced rather than re-anchored: the split between the two sanitizer configs is now pinned on the reason that survives — the diagram filter must permit the `<style>` the document policy forbids.
